"Not so bad for travel, but rush hour is horrible"

I-95 through much of Baltimore is actually an overpass. Just about a mile after entering Baltimore City and passing Washington Blvd., you will be on the overpass until you go under the tunnel and then back on it again until it meets I-895 again. It's elevation off the ground is great because if you're traveling through towards DC or Philly, you will still get to see all of Baltimore's skyline from a close enough distance. It gets really backed up during rush hour around the Fort McHenry Tunnel. This is despite it being one of the few 8-laned tunnels in the country, if not the only one. But accidents are so prevalent around here. The speed limit is 55mph, but out-of-towners normally go 70 to 80mph. Be careful to keep your eyes on the road around here.
